refactor: move auto-fetch from global preference to repository settings

This commit is contained in:
leo 2024-09-26 10:50:21 +08:00
parent 8e31ea9140
commit 1ba294a07b
No known key found for this signature in database
25 changed files with 166 additions and 227 deletions

View file

@ -94,6 +94,18 @@ namespace SourceGit.Models
set;
} = new AvaloniaList<IssueTrackerRule>();
public bool EnableAutoFetch
{
get;
set;
} = false;
public int AutoFetchInterval
{
get;
set;
} = 10;
public void PushCommitMessage(string message)
{
var existIdx = CommitMessages.IndexOf(message);